How "Over-Registering" Can Save You Money

Wedding registries are a huge help when it comes to gifts for weddings. They help the guests to know what you actually want and will use, which saves time and money for both them and you. But, how can you make the most out of this beneficial arrangement? If your goal is to avoid spending large amounts of your own money, you can over-register. Here are some reasons why registering for too much can save you money in the long run.

  1. Only Get Gifts You Want: Guaranteed
    If you register for gifts but the list runs out of items, people will buy you gifts they think you need. Aka, they will guess. While you can trust that there won’t be duplicates from the registry, you have no control over what they are going to get you. You will want to make sure to over-register so that whenever someone buys you a gift it is something you have picked out and will be able to use. 
  2. Wedding Registry = Coupons
    Keep an eye on what different stores are offering for after-wedding discounts on uncompleted registry lists. Many stores will keep your registry open for a time after the wedding, allowing time for late gifts, and also giving you discounts for purchases you make directly from your registry. Many of these discounts are around 10%, so having a registry that is larger than what you think you will receive and making use of that discount after your wedding can end up saving you a good amount of money -- especially if you put furniture or larger home appliances on your registry.
  3. More Options, More Gifts
    Getting what you need is important, but making sure your guests will be able to afford what you register for is also important. If you make a registry that has everything you need but is way above what your guests can realistically pay for then you won’t be gaining much from the arrangement in the long run. If you are going to register for some higher dollar items then make sure to register for some that are under $50 as well. This will not only create a diverse amount of gifts but will also allow guests to work within their own budget, and thus increasing the total amount of gifts you receive. The more options your guests have for gift ideas the more they will be able to purchase.
